Soccer · San BrunoAs just announced by the West Coast Conference, the conference Presidents' Council has approved the Executive Council's proposals on championships for men's soccer, women's soccer and softball. Conference championships in these three sports will begin in the 2026-27 academic year. Greensboro, North Carolina · GreensboroGREENSBORO, N.C., For just the second time in program history and the first time in 17 years, Saint Mary's has produced an ABCA All-American in junior first baseman Eddie Madrigal. Madrigal was named to the American Baseball Coaches Association (ABCA) All-America Second Team as the lone WCC recipient.
